Output 7e50ab425a6296fc5e6483b40129baf0a0bef9ab0ece237bc64aebc64c8407c6:0

value
1051504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e34d732fad3f5f0566161edc6f7a53ba951a993 OP_EQUAL
address
3EewBDPbR5LSi8fojYVMdk2FCBTGpX17qH
transaction
7e50ab425a6296fc5e6483b40129baf0a0bef9ab0ece237bc64aebc64c8407c6
spent
true